The Importance Of Consolidating Your Pensions

As you progress through your career, it’s not uncommon to accumulate multiple pension pots with different employers Managing these various pension schemes can become overwhelming and confusing, leading many individuals to consider consolidating their pensions into one manageable account

Consolidating your pensions involves transferring the funds from your various pension pots into a single scheme This can offer a range of benefits, making it easier to keep track of your retirement savings and potentially improving your investment performance

One of the main advantages of consolidating your pensions is the simplicity it offers Instead of trying to keep track of multiple accounts with different providers, you can consolidate everything into one easy-to-manage pension pot This can reduce the administrative burden of managing your retirement savings and make it easier to stay on top of your pension planning.

Consolidating your pensions can also give you greater control over your retirement savings By bringing all of your pension pots together, you can review your investment strategy as a whole and ensure that your savings are working efficiently towards your retirement goals This can help you to make more informed decisions about your pension investments and potentially improve your overall investment performance.

Many pension providers charge fees for managing your accounts, and these costs can quickly add up if you have multiple pension pots By consolidating your pensions into one account, you can reduce the overall fees you pay and potentially increase the value of your retirement savings over time.

Consolidating your pensions can also make it easier to keep track of your retirement savings and ensure that you are on track to meet your retirement goals By consolidating your pensions into one account, you can easily monitor your progress towards your retirement savings targets and make adjustments as needed to achieve your desired outcome This can give you peace of mind and confidence in your retirement planning, knowing that your savings are working efficiently towards your long-term financial goals.

Before you consolidate your pensions, it’s important to carefully consider the impact on your overall retirement planning You should review the terms and conditions of your existing pension schemes, as well as any charges or fees that may apply to consolidating your pensions You should also seek advice from a financial advisor to ensure that consolidating your pensions is the right decision for your individual circumstances and retirement goals.
